Former Soviet republics Compared by Environment > Climate change > CO2 emissions > Kt

DEFINITION: CO2 emissions (kt). Carbon dioxide emissions are those stemming from the burning of fossil fuels and the manufacture of cement. They include carbon dioxide produced during consumption of solid, liquid, and gas fuels and gas flaring.

CONTENTS

# COUNTRY AMOUNT DATE GRAPH HISTORY
1 Russia 1.74 million 2010
2 Ukraine 304,804.71 2010
3 Kazakhstan 248,728.94 2010
4 Uzbekistan 104,443.49 2010
5 Belarus 62,221.66 2010
6 Turkmenistan 53,054.16 2010
7 Azerbaijan 45,731.16 2010
8 Estonia 18,338.67 2010
9 Lithuania 13,560.57 2010
10 Latvia 7,616.36 2010
11 Kyrgyzstan 6,398.91 2010
12 Georgia 6,241.23 2010
13 Moldova 4,855.11 2010
14 Armenia 4,220.72 2010
15 Tajikistan 2,860.26 2010
